The hire is the latest expansive move for Milbank in London, amid a hot hiring market.Alston & Bird, Amid Busy Lateral Hiring Year, Boosts Profits
Profit per equity partner increased 8.1% to $2,434,000 in a year when the firm added the highest number of lateral partners in its history. After opening a London office in 2019, Alston hired six partners and increased its London head count to 19 lawyers.Latest US Firm Launches In London Via Acquisition
